Foundations of Distributed Data Management Old and complex problem New aspects: Web scale, Web services… Lots of works, lots of ad hoc techniques, very messy, redundant Need for simple and clean mathematical foundations To understand what we are doing To manage the complexity To teach the topic To push the limits In general: need for foundational works

Application: Management of personal data All kinds Music, movie, pictures House appliances data, car Bank, taxes, bills, pda, PC, work, etc. Issues Augmented reality interface – no keyboard no computer Confidentiality: protect access to this data In general: new interfaces In general: confidentiality
